Transaction 50db6908616a68b38937cf33b5f7c2ae9a63dfffdbe747010372ec124e1f617a
1 Input
2 Outputs
- 50db6908616a68b38937cf33b5f7c2ae9a63dfffdbe747010372ec124e1f617a:0
- 50db6908616a68b38937cf33b5f7c2ae9a63dfffdbe747010372ec124e1f617a:1
value 1669
address 1Bo7Qe3SjtjHxETz95PdCD6sX6RM22LjFX
value 1807503
address 3MjCVPiYQeSZKv3sAB5Z96eP9uUwuHVXnZ